Foundation Overview

Based in Wilmington, DE, Frank And Yetta Chaiken Foundation Inc has awarded 146 grants totaling $541,136 to organizations in Delaware, New York and 7 other states across the US. Individual grants range from $25 to $78,765, with a median award of $100.

Geographic Focus
Delaware

73% of all grants are concentrated in Delaware, demonstrating highly focused geographic giving. This foundation prioritizes deep community impact in its primary service area. Within Delaware, funding concentrates in Wilmington (85%), Newark (12%), Neewark (3%).
